Maldivian Chicken Biriyani

Cultural Context

Originating from South Asian culinary traditions, Maldivian Chicken Biriyani reflects the rich flavors and spices of the Indian subcontinent. Traditionally enjoyed during festive occasions and gatherings, this dish highlights the use of local ingredients like coconut and spices. Today, biriyani has become popular not only in the Maldives but also across the globe, with numerous regional variations emerging.

Servings4
1.5 lbs chicken
2 cups basmati rice
2 medium onions
4 cloves garlic
1 tablespoon ginger
2 green chilies
2 medium tomatoes
1 cup yogurt
1 cup coconut milk
2 bay leaves
1 stick cinnamon
5 pods cardamom
5 cloves
1 teaspoon turmeric
1 tablespoon salt
1/4 cup cilantro
2 tablespoons lemon juice

1

Marinate chicken with yogurt, garlic, ginger, turmeric, and salt for at least 30 minutes.

2

Heat oil in a large pot over medium heat until shimmering.

3

Add sliced onions and cook until golden brown, about 5-7 minutes.

4

Stir in green chilies and diced tomatoes; cook until tomatoes soften, about 3-4 minutes.

5

Add marinated chicken and cook until no longer pink, about 8-10 minutes.

6

Add coconut milk and bring to a simmer.

7

Stir in rinsed basmati rice and bay leaves, then add enough water to cover the rice.

8

Season with salt and spices like cinnamon, cardamom, and cloves; mix well.

9

Cover pot and reduce heat to low; cook for about 20-25 minutes until rice is tender.

10

Remove from heat and let sit, covered, for 10 minutes.

11

Fluff rice with a fork and garnish with cilantro and lemon juice before serving.
